{"product_id":"agave-americana-century-plant","title":"Agave americana, Century Plant - Succulent Plant","description":"\u003cdiv class=\"product-description\"\u003e\n    \u003ch2\u003eAgave americana - Century Plant\u003c\/h2\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eThe Agave americana, commonly known as the Century Plant, is a striking succulent native to the arid regions of Mexico and the southwestern United States. This hardy plant is renowned for its dramatic rosette of thick, fleshy leaves that can grow up to 6 feet long, making it a stunning focal point in any garden or landscape. With its architectural form and striking blue-green color, the Century Plant is not only visually appealing but also remarkably drought-tolerant, thriving in low-water conditions.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\n    \u003cp\u003eWhat makes the Agave americana special is its impressive longevity and unique lifecycle. Although it can live for decades, it flowers only once in its lifetime, producing a towering stalk that can reach heights of up to 30 feet. After flowering, the plant dies, but it often produces numerous offsets, ensuring its legacy continues. This fascinating reproductive strategy has earned it the nickname \"Century Plant,\" although it typically flowers in 10 to 30 years.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\n    \u003cp\u003eOne of the standout features of the Agave americana is its versatility. Beyond its ornamental value, it has been used for centuries in traditional medicine and as a source of fiber for textiles. The sap can also be fermented to produce a popular alcoholic beverage known as mezcal.
